Daily Pages: Thursday3 for Spooky (Cute) Season

Using up my stuff + journaling some words

I love having Thursday3 to rely on when I’m not sure what I want to do. Today was especially perfect, because I’m still getting a feel for this notebook and it’s lined pages. I generally stay away from lined books because the lines honestly just get in my way, but I really wanted to use the cute notebook with the pumpkin on the front cover.

I think this book is going to have a bit more journaling than some of my other notebooks, and that’s just going to be because of the lines in the notebook, and I’m always pulled to write in them lol. I’ll definitely cover up a bunch of the pages with patterned paper or gel prints (like yesterday’s page); but the lines are really great for journaling—and Thursday3 is a big journaling page, so it was perfect for today.

Technique of the Day

Today was an easy day—I grabbed some stickers out of my October zipper envelope where I keep all my spooky season supplies. I was looking for something that had three medium-sized images that would work well as thursday3 number anchors. I went with the glittery owls, and I love them.

I added some numbers with my alpha stamps and my favorite purple ink and then journaled to fill up the page. I had a little bit of extra white space at the end, which I filled up with some more stamping and the rest of the stickers on my sticker sheet. You all know how much I love using up my supplies in my Daily Pages notebooks, and this is one more sticker sheet done!

Tips & Creative Wisdom

Anchor Yourself with Three

When you’re not sure what to make, Thursday3 is always there to catch you. Three quick notes about your life = instant page.

Pro Tip: Use numbers or icons as anchors—photos, stickers, doodles—anything that marks out three spots on the page.
